Phineas and Ferb is well liked because in addition to having plenty of jokes for adults and decent art, it's completely genuine and self-aware. Like there's not an ounce of cynicism or meanness to be found in the show and what it does and that's pretty refreshing these days. And despite who it's supposed to be for, it doesn't condescend and gives the older audience reasons to enjoy it just as much as the younger.

I actually don't like Phineas and Ferb that much, mostly due to how repetitive and annoying the jokes get, and how everyone acts exactly the same as their limited character is defined as from episode to episode, and therefore I feel like the optimism and positivity is faked; it's a byproduct of nobody ever growing or changing as characters. There's no arcing or development and nobody learns anything.

In comparison I feel like here, everyone's a real character. Dipper and Mabel might be jerks to each other from time, or to Stan, but they learn and change as the show progresses and even when they're at their worst to each other (which is quite frankly, not bad at all, really), they obviously still love and support each other. Plus the jokes aren't all meta or an ouroboros of references to itself like P and F has become, and the animation is a lot better.

So basically, yes, it is a very positive show. It is obviously inspired by Twin Peaks so you do get that sense of "something is very, very wrong with this town" sort of uneasiness that I at least felt watching TP.

Here's a nice little bit from TV Guide with some tidbits from Alex Hirsch. I think "Alfred Molina voicing a bear made out of multiple bears" is perhaps the most Gravity Falls-ish sentence there can be- if that doesn't show how weird the show is, nothing will.

And, for purposes of stuff, the schedule for the premiere weekend and episodes debuting next month:

All times Eastern and Pacific

Premiere Weekend Schedule:

Friday, June 29 (TONIGHT)
9:00pm 105 Tourist Trapped (encore presentation)
9:30pm 101 The Legend of the Gobblewonker

Saturday, June 30
9:25pm 102 Headhunters

Sunday, July 1 (encore presentations)
9:00pm 105 Tourist Trapped
9:30pm 101 The Legend of the Gobblewonker
10:00pm 102 Headhunters

July Episode Premieres:

July 6 9:30pm 104 The Hand That Rocks the Mabel
July 13 9:30pm 103 The Inconviencing
July 20 9:30pm 106 Dipper vs. Manliness
